The Lark was designed in 1966 by Michael Jackson, designer of many National 12 and Merlin Rockets, with the first one launched in 1967. The hull made of G.R.P. is 4.065 metres in length, and carries a sail area of 9.75 square metres upwind and a spinnaker of 7.4 square metres. The class currently has a Portsmouth Yardstick of 1073, making it one of the fastest non-trapeze dinghies around!

Founded in 1937, The Brixham Yacht Club is recognised as one of the premier clubs on the South coast of England, as it continues to grow in both membership and stature.

The clubroom, formerly a sail-loft, together with the Jubilee Room Restaurant, provide panoramic views of the busy, but quaint, working harbour of Brixham and the beautiful waters and coastlines of Torbay and Lyme Bay.

Being adjacent to the harbour, The Brixham Yacht Club is accessible at all times and provides launching facilities at all states of the tide. The Club offers and excellent venue for social and competitive sailing events and continues to host Open Weekend, National, European and World Championship events.
